Federal Appeals Court May Vacate SEC Rule 151A

A federal appeals court indicated that it may vacate SEC Rule 151A which would require that fixed indexed annuities be regulated as securities by the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

The court determined that the SEC may have failed to properly assess the 151A's potential impact on efficiency, competition and capital formation in the industry.
